Build AI agents using OpenAI Agents SDK with support for Gemini and other LLMs via direct integration or OpenRouter.
The recommended approach is to use AsyncOpenAI with Gemini's OpenAI-compatible endpoint. This avoids quota issues with LiteLLM.
OpenRouter provides access to multiple models through a single API, including free options.
